Becoming more self aware on how businesses profit off your attention is useful to identify where they are trying to push you.
For instance, it is now more well known that Netflix will customize series and movies thumbnails based on what the algorithm says about you. This is to encourage users to watch content because it may seem like something they have already watched, or already enjoy.
So in the case of Netflix, attention to a particular series/movie will create user dedication towards their Netflix subscription making them less unlikely to cancel it.
